SUBJECT: ECUADOR -- DEMARCHE ON COUNTERTERRORISM OBJECTIVES
OF UNSCR 1267
REF: STATE 65371
1. On May 23 post delivered reftel points to Lourdes Puma
Puma, Director of Multilateral Affairs in the Ministry of
Foreign Affairs. Puma said the GOE understands the
importance of strengthening its ability to monitor financial
transactions in order to stop individuals or entities
suspected of terrorist financing. She pointed out that the
GOE currently has draft counterterrorist financing
legislation that it hopes to pass soon.
